Grackle Docs Installation

Use the Grackle Docs add-on to run the accessibility tests on your document. By utilizing Grackle Docs, you gain access to a range of features that not only identify potential accessibility issues but also provide insights and recommendations for improvement.

  1. Open a Google document.
  2. Go to Add-ons and select Get add-ons.

  3. It opens another window, type in the search “Grackle Docs,” and select the Grackle Docs option.

  4. Once you navigate to Grackle Docs, click on the Install button.

  5. When you click Install, a pop-up window appears, asking for permission to install, select Continue.

  6. Choose a Google account to continue with Grackle Docs. This adds Grackle Docs to that Google account.
  7. After you select a Google account to continue, allow Grackle Docs to access your Google account. (Note: If you are a student or employee at ECC, use your ECC student email account @student.elgin.edu to access all of Grackle's features. You will only have limited access to Grackle's features when using your personal Google account.)

  8. Grackle Docs should now be installed, and a pop-up appears describing two ways to find Grackle Docs.
